About the exhibition

The graduation exhibition 2024 Free Education for All: It is Time presents a new generation of artists who are currently graduating from one of the country's oldest and most prestigious higher art educations we have in Norway, the Master of Fine Arts at the Oslo Academy of the Arts.

The exhibition presents works by: Abirami Logendran, Adin Music, Ane Barstad Solvang, Anne-Marte Før, Edvard Skodvin, Eili Bråstad, Ghazaal Nasiri, Iben Erik Bødker-Næss, Kim Henning Andreassen, Lea Stuedahl, Madelon Verbeek, Paulina Stroynowska, Sampson Addae, Santiago Díaz Escamilla, Steinar Brovold Hauge and Wenche Sandra M.
